Wild ‘N Out comes to Kia Center this weekend

Nick Cannon’s Wild ‘N Out: The Final Lap Tour is heading to downtown Orlando this weekend, and tickets are still available.

The show will be held at the Kia Center (400 W Church Street in Orlando) on Saturday, September 7. Doors open at 7 p.m., with the event kicking off at 8 p.m.

For 20 years, the popular television show Wild ‘N Out has served as a launching pad for some of today’s biggest stars, including Kevin Hart and Pete Davidson. The show has also been a platform for up-and-coming comedians and musicians, providing a unique opportunity to showcase their talents to a national audience.

In recognition of the show’s cultural impact, Wild ‘N Out has received an NAACP Image Award for Outstanding Variety Show (series or special). Extending beyond television, the show has helped shape comedy trends while fostering a generation of performers who blend humor with social commentary.

The Wild ‘N Out Live: The Final Lap Tour promises a night filled with laughter and surprises. The show’s cast members, both past and present, will engage audiences with improv games and freestyle battles.

In addition, the tour will include musical performances by some of today’s hottest artists, along with interactive audience games that will allow fans to take part in the show’s iconic challenges.
